Cooper Series Drivers Get Extra Testing Time
ST. PETERSBURG, FLA. (March 3, 2004) - The Cooper Tires Championship Series today announced additional testing opportunities for all its competitors. The Cooper Series has booked a full test day at Road Atlanta and the Mid-Ohio Sports Car Course.
In preparation for the Drift Atlanta race event, the Cooper Series will conduct a full day of testing April 22, 2004, at Road Atlanta. Exclusively for Formula Ford Zetec Championship, Formula SCCA Championship and Avon Sports 2000 Championship competitors, the test will feature hour-long sessions from 9 a.m. to 5 p.m. The test, which replaces the limited test day on April 23, will give teams and drivers the opportunity to prepare for the second Cooper Series event of 2004.
The test at Mid-Ohio will take place June 2, 2004. Occurring just following the fourth event of the 2004 season, the test will provide teams and drivers vital track time on the technically demanding road course. Like Road Atlanta, the test at Mid-Ohio will feature hour-long sessions from 9 a.m. to 5 p.m.
Widely regarded as North America's premier training series, the Cooper Tires Championship Series offers the complete motorsports education, with emphasis on cost-effective racing. Racing throughout the United States and Canada, the Cooper Series will showcase the best young drivers from around the world on a challenging mix of racetracks.
The 2004 Cooper Tires Championship Series season gets underway March 16-18, 2004 at Sebring International Raceway. Racing at Sebring will be the Zetec Championship and the Formula SCCA.
